Soooo. I elluded to this in JSS's post below, but would love to hear A13's thoughts.

We are in the midst of sleep hell in my house :(

It started two weeks ago. The same time I noticed her top gums were very swollen. Well, DD is a horrible teether, so essentially I buckled in. With her bottom teeth, especially the first one we went through three weeks of sleep hell before it got better and soon after popped. It got so bad I took her to the pedi - who was an as* and told me there was nothing wrong.

So, for the most part she's been going down ok. The bigger issue is that she wakes up, ALL.NIGHT.LONG. Every teething remedy we try works for a little while, but then proves ineffective....It's maddening. Her newest thing last night was to cry whenever you didn't have a hand on her.

My question for you ladies - how long do I let this go on? I believe it's her teeth and she's just a slow teether, but I will feel AWFUL if there is something bigger bothering her.If the pattern is consistent with her bottom teeth - then Friday will make the three week mark... and maybe things will get better? I don't know - and now I have DH telling me we need to let her cry it out. I'm not opposed to sleep training, but I am opposed to doing it when I believe she's in pain. I am also wondering if there is some seperation anxiety going on....

Thoughts?

Edited to add: She's also been doing this weird thing lately where she furosiously moves her head back and forth - imagine like an escimo kiss. I have no idea why - but am frustrated because I know there's a reason she's doing it. Any thoughts on that as well? She does it a lot when I put her down in her crib.

  • I was going to ask about meds too -- and those hylands teething tabs, which DO seem to work on James.  

    Re; the eskimo kiss -- my definition of an eskimo kiss is brushing your eyelashes on somebody, but if you're talking about head-shaking like "no no no no no," then yes -- LO does this, usually when he's teething or has an ear infection.

    Other than teething or good ol' fashioned separation anxiety, it sounds like maybe an ear infection - any ear pulling going on?
